The invention provides a tower crane abnormity early warning method and system based on image processing. The method comprises the following steps that whether a tower crane lifting mechanism brake fails or not is judged; if a fault occurs, a real-time ideal droppable area is obtained according to state parameters of a tower crane and a hoisted heavy object; a non-dropping area is removed from thereal-time ideal droppable area to obtain a real-time actual droppable area; a ground image corresponding to the real-time actual droppable area is obtained, and a real-time optimal dropping area in the real-time actual droppable area is selected based on the ground image; and a light beam irradiates the real-time optimal dropping area, and a lifting hook is moved to the position above the real-time optimal dropping area. According to the tower crane abnormity early warning method and system based on image processing, the heavy object can be moved to the real-time optimal dropping area in timeafter the fault occurs, and related personnel are reminded to be far away from the real-time optimal dropping area by the light beam, so that personal and property losses caused by falling of the heavy object is avoided.
